This math topic focuses on solving systems of linear equations by substitution. It involves substituting one equation into another to form a single equation that can be solved for one variable. The problems provided require substituting a given expression into another equation and simplifying to solve for the unknown variable. This includes determining the correct simplified form from multiple answer choices. These exercises practice algebraic manipulation skills and help in understanding how to isolate variables to find specific solutions in linear equation systems.
